Ravenclaw Midnight Blueberry Cheesecake

  • Total Time: 3 hours
  • Yield: 12 servings

Ingredients

– 1 Β½ cups graham cracker crumbs

– ΒΌ cup granulated sugar

– 6 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ted

– 4 packages (8 oz each) cream cheese, softened

– 1 cup granulated sugar

– 1 cup sour cream

– 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

– 3 large eggs

– 1 cup fresh or frozen blueberries

– 2 tablespoons granulated sugar

– 1 tablespoon lemon juice

– 1 teaspoon cornstarch mixed with 2 tablespoons water

– Edible silver dust or sprinkles for a starry night effect

Instructions

1-Prepare the Crust: Mix together 1 Β½ cups graham cracker crumbs, ΒΌ cup granulated sugar, and 6 tablespoons melted unsalted butter until well combined. Press this mixture firmly into the bottom of a greased 9-inch springform pan and bake for 8 to 10 minutes, then let it cool.

2-Make the Cheesecake Batter: In a large bowl, beat 4 packages of softened cream cheese with 1 cup granulated sugar until smooth. Add 1 cup sour cream and 1 teaspoon vanilla extract, mixing until fully incorporated, then beat in 3 large eggs one at a time, just until combined to keep the texture perfect.

3-Create the Midnight Blueberry Swirl: In a saucepan over medium heat, combine 1 cup blueberries, 2 tablespoons granulated sugar, and 1 tablespoon lemon juice. Cook until the blueberries soften and release their juices, then stir in the cornstarch mixture and simmer for 2 to 3 minutes until thickened. Let it cool before using.

4-Assemble and Bake: Pour the cheesecake batter over the cooled crust and smooth the top. Add dollops of the blueberry swirl and use a skewer to create swirls. Bake for 50 to 60 minutes until the edges are set but the center still jiggles slightly, then turn off the oven and let it cool inside for 1 hour. Refrigerate for at least 4 hours or overnight to set completely.

5-Decorate and Serve: Dust with edible silver dust or sprinkles for that starry look, and slice it up for your next themed party or quiet book night.

Notes

🧁 Avoid overmixing batter to prevent cracks.
❄️ Cool cheesecake gradually inside oven with door slightly open.
πŸ”΅ Prepare blueberry swirl up to 3 days ahead; store refrigerated.
πŸͺ Use gluten-free crumbs for gluten-free crust.
🌱 For vegan version, use dairy-free cream cheese and flaxseed egg.
πŸ’™ Use butterfly pea flower or blue spirulina powder for deeper blue swirls.
🍫 Create black crust with crushed chocolate sandwich cookies or black cocoa powder.
πŸ”ͺ Dip knife in hot water and wipe between cuts for clean slices.
